Schiffer Publishing, Ltd. (Atglen, PA) is a family-owned publisher with more than 5,700 titles in print and a broad catalog of books, including non-fiction books on art, decorative arts, architecture, design, antiques, military history, maritime subjects, photography, fashion, house and garden, food, history, crafts, woodworking, regional topics, and more. Located on the Schiffer Book Farm near the Chester/Lancaster county line, we are two miles from the Parkesburg station on Amtrak's Keystone Line.

Customer Care Representative

The role of Customer Care Representative at Schiffer Publishing is an integral part of the business efficiencies that occur daily. The main focus of this job is to provide each caller, whether a customer, vendor, or author, the best experience possible. The person in this role must be patient, and conscious of producing high quality, detailed work based on established procedures and guidelines. Because this role requires processing orders, payments, and email requests, not to mention staying on top of inventory, consistent, error-free work output is essential. Although this person must have a strong ability to multi-task, they must also learn to complete a single assignment and prioritize correctly in order to ensure accuracy. Job knowledge and competency are built through structured step-by-step training and positive, supportive coaching from management and peers. Communication with others is based on knowledge of repetitive job routines, and makes this person a “go-to” for team members who may have particular questions about a book. Because of the repetitive nature of tasks, this person will quickly become an expert, technical in nature, who’s role is critical to the team’s and business’ success.

Role and Responsibilities

  • The ability to ensure a positive experience with our customers (and authors) by working to give each caller or visitor the highest quality of service. This includes placing orders, answering product and service questions, and solving problems, when they occur, in a courteous and professional manner.
  • Manage inbound communications
  • Answer phones professionally and with respect
  • Forward, answer, or process emails received to main email address, website, and voicemail
  • Support inside sales initiatives, make outbound calls to connect with current customers and prospects
  • Process orders including those faxed, emailed, mailed, internal, and EDI
  • EDI – Pull orders, confirm, edit, and update in Vendor Central for Amazon
  • Process credit card orders daily and transmit credit card payments
  • Print, sort, and deliver orders to the warehouse
  • Process customer returns and coordinate credits
  • Credit Application – process/check/approve
  • Maintain up-to-date records and contact information for customers and authors
  • Schedule incoming containers delivery with freight forwarder and coordinate with warehouse
  • Create records for new books and manage all books in inventory management system
  • Prepare and release customer backorders for new releases and inventory
  • Communicate new releases to each external rep and in-house team member
  • Prepare spreadsheets for external reps and in-house team to alert them of new titles arriving 
  • Update product metadata management to customers 
  • Upload images to customer portals including Amazon, Schiffer, Barnes and Noble and Edelweiss
  • Keep warehouse inventory up to date/accurate
  • Month-End processing of orders and inventory
  • Catalog Requests and Weekly catalog mailing
  • Complete any projects given to them by the Customer Care Manager
  • Assist with special projects
